Output 1dc830a7959ae87b7cf55b068c9fd9b38e0e327061bc20cb28f273911778265f:0

value
18814981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d8e3e9564ca9a907de03484d0d2ac5e62de09e6 OP_EQUAL
address
3QohHPuM93bzbRzdLbjy4HbBnwXuTYUM2x
transaction
1dc830a7959ae87b7cf55b068c9fd9b38e0e327061bc20cb28f273911778265f
spent
true